President Buhari meets Bill Gates, Dangote in New York (Photos)

Head of states, President Muhammadu Buhari met with world’s richest man, Bill Gates and Africa’s richest man, Aliko Dangote in New York.

During the meeting earlier today, the President lauded the contributions of the Bill and Melinda Gates Foundation, as well as Aliko Dangote Foundation to humanitarian and developmental activities in Nigeria.

Aliko Dangote revealed that he plans to give out a chunk of his wealth to charity just like Microsoft founder, Bill Gates.

In his speech at the 2019 Goalkeepers’ event hosted by the Bill and Melinda Gates Foundation in New York on Wednesday September 24, Dangote expressed delight in Bill Gates’ philanthropy which is quite evident in Nigeria.

According to him, the billionaire philanthropist has invested so much in people he has no relationship with and this has made him (Dangote) a better person.

He said,

“When I started my foundation in 1994, I never realized we had this massive challenge in the health sector.

“Really, it was mind-boggling when we had this agreement to collaborate with the Bill and Melinda Gates Foundation and that really opened my eyes to realize that there are a lot of challenges in health.

“At that time I didn’t have the opportunity of meeting Bill but meeting Bill changed me into a different person. This is somebody that has nothing to do with us in Africa or Nigeria but he is putting his money and his soul into everything.

“He is very committed to helping humanity and that really surprises me a lot and I realized that he is a simple person and I never knew Bill would be this simple. He is a very soft-spoken guy and kindhearted.

“It is very difficult to find people like Bill in this world. Bill, we are very grateful and I can assure you that with my association with Bill, my only prayer is that in the next few years, I will try and give my chunk of wealth to charity.”
